We are recruiting Care Workers on a fixed term basis (12 months) to join our Crisis Response Team, a community‑based service delivering essential support within individuals’ own homes. The service operates 24 hours a day; therefore, shift working will be required (specific shift patterns to be confirmed).

 The following posts are available:

  • 7 × Care Workers – 21 hours per week, worked over 7 days (fixed term, 12 months)
  • 1 × Care Worker – 21 hours per week, weekends only (fixed term, 12 months)

As a member of the team, a primary function will be to provide short term supports to individual to return from hospital or to prevent admission, in addition to other aspects of service delivery such as:

  • Assisting individuals who have fallen but are uninjured
  • Responding to telecare alerts when individuals activate their pendant alarm or when no movement is detected in their home

It is essential that candidate have the following:

  • Experience working in a community‑based care setting
  • Literacy and numeracy skills appropriate to the role
  • Knowledge of a wide range of health-related issues
  • SVQ Level 2 (Social Services and Healthcare SCQF Level 6) or willingness to work towards achieving it to meet SSSC registration requirements
  • A full driving licence

 This position requires registration with the SSSC.  The successful candidate will have six months from the date of commencement of this post to become registered with the SSSC.  SSSC stipulate you must submit your application within three months of your start date.  If you are already registered with SSSC you will be required to add West Lothian Council to your account

 This post is considered Regulated Work with children and/or protected adults under the Protection of Vulnerable Groups (PVG) Scotland Act 2007. From 28 February 2011 preferred candidates will be required to join the PVG Scheme or undergo a PVG Scheme update check prior to a formal offer of employment being made by West Lothian Council
